A Border Policewoman thwarted a potential stabbing in downtown Jerusalem on Tuesday afternoon, after she stopped an Arab terrorist with a weapon. 

The soldier first flagged the Palestinian Arab woman after she was spotted walking on Dorot Rishonim street in Jerusalem and acting suspiciously. 

The Border Policewoman, keeping a safe distance, pulled the woman aside and searched her purse - and found a long screwdriver. 

Under interrogation, the Palestinian Arab suspect admitted she had been stalking the street with intent of carrying out an attack.

An investigation into the incident is ongoing.
